Tina Lambert is a vibrant, compassionate and dedicated Licensed Marriage & Family Therapist. She holds a Bachelor’s Degree in Family & Child Sciences from Florida State University, a Master’s Degree in Family Therapy from Nova Southeastern University and is currently working on her doctorate in Marriage & Family Therapy. Tina specializes in supporting children who have experienced child neglect, abuse and trauma, pre & post adoption issues, foster care, self-esteem challenges, behavioral issues, ADHD, anxiety, and depression. She is able to do this by drawing from various therapeutic modalities which include Systems Theory, Solution Focused Brief Therapy,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Play Therapy, and other Strength-Based Approaches. Tina’s ultimate goal is to create a safe, non-judgement environment for her clients to be themselves.
